I'm trying to setup a triggered program (COBOL) running on AS400 with v. 4.2.1 of MQ. What I need to do is when a message arrives on a queue, trigger a process which refers to the program. The program will then accept as input, two parms, an input queue and an output queue. This program will then do a GET (Browse) from the input queue and a PUT to the output queue (RMTq).
For some reason this isn't working. The messages arrive, but it doesn't appear that the triggered process/program is being run.
Is this possible in the program to connect to the QMgr, open two different queues, GET(browse) one and PUT to the other ?
I basically want to put copies of any messages on a different QMgr with the same exact queues.
